Title: Des Delatorre has passed away
Post by: Dave W on February 02, 2018, 12:20:29 PM
It is with the greatest sadness that we wish to advise forum members that our Forum owner & administrator, Des Delatorre, passed away today.

Des suffered a serious heart attack a week ago and despite intensive hospital care, he has suffered another heart attack.

This Forum and the WW1 modelling family was a great passion for him and the challenge now is to continue the Forum in his memory.

Decisions about the Forum's future will be be made later but it will continue as it is in the meantime.

Des' wife Adrienne posted on Facebook: "It is with the heaviest heart, and deepest sadness, to tell all, that the love of my life and soulmate Des passed away this morning. David Wilson will be looking after the forum for the time being. Thank you to all for being the hugest part of Des' life."

Des was an outstanding modeller as anyone who saw his work on this forum, his website and Facebook would know. His passion for WW1 modelling saw him create this Forum and make an enormous contribution toward WW1 modelling.

We are devastated by his passing.

More information will be posted at a later date.

Dave Wilson
Gold Coast
Australia
